  • FY20 PIER Update

    Due to COVID-19 and the limitations presented with access to assets, the FY20 Physical Inventory and Equipment Review (PIER) will be rescheduled from the previously slated April 30, 2020 deadline.The FY20 PIER will be rescheduled to start on July 1, 2020, with a deadline of August 31, 2020
